Mō te tūnga | About the role

Ara Poutama Aotearoa is a core part of New Zealand's Justice Sector and manages custodial and community-based sentences imposed by the Courts. Our vision is to improve public safety and reduce re-offending through strong leadership, capable staff, a safe working environment and effective partnerships. This role is challenging and diverse and requires the ability to work effectively with a wide range of individuals and groups. The Manager Industries will manage each industry specific environment, including health and safety, risk/issue management and be responsible for budget management.

The role is diverse and key is the responsibility for managing offender employment activities on site and supporting the Assistant Prison Director to deliver quality outcomes across the various work areas. The Manager Industries will be managing instructors and principal instructors, including the coordination of training and development, delegation of duties and performance management.

With a range of work programmes at Waikeria Prison this is an opportunity to lead the team providing valued training, education, and industry relevant skills to people whom we manage. Areas you may be expected to oversee could include catering, kitchen, laundry, dairy farming, horticulture, grounds maintenance and painting.

Mō mātou | About us

Ara Poutama Aotearoa is a name that has been gifted to us and is our commitment to improving the oranga and safety of the people, whānau, and that of the communities we serve across the motu. 

As a values-led organisation, we use the principles of rangatira (leadership), manaaki (respect), wairua (spirituality), kaitiaki (guardianship) and whānau (relationships) to shape how we work and deliver the outcomes in our strategy - Hōkai Rangi
